[ic] selected tag use on item-quantity fix?
At 11:33 AM 7/19/2002 -0700, you wrote:
>Im having difficulty implementing a memory for pulldown
>My client would like to limit the purchase per item to 5
>sounds good to me Ill just drop a pull down in there, right?
>
>NO,.
>
>This is what happens
>
> Pre-IC-Processing::
>
> [item-quantity]
> <select name="[quantity-name]">
> <option [selected [item-quantity] 0]>0
> <option [selected [item-quantity] 1]>1
> <option [selected [item-quantity] 2]>2
> <option [selected [item-quantity] 3]>3
> <option [selected [item-quantity] 4]>4
> <option [selected [item-quantity] 5]>5
> </select>
Even if your syntax was right (which it is not), it would not work until
the first time the basket was recalculated *after* each item was added. It
is better to do something like this with perl:
<select name="[quantity-name]">
[calc]
my $qty = q{[item-quantity]};
my $out;
foreach (qw(1 2 3 4 5)) {
$out .= qq{<option value=$_};
$out .= q{ SELECTED} if $qty == $_;
$out .= qq{> $_\n};
}
return $out;
[/calc]
</select>
...an unrefined example but it should work.
